Boardman Community Development Association
Beautify and increase the livability of the Boardman community focusing on housing, commercial and retail development, and workforce training. The association collaborates with other organizations, municipalities, business leaders and residents to support progressive development in the community.

About Boardman Community Development Association
Based on IRS filings
Boardman Community Development Association is a nonprofit organization focused on Community Improvement & Capacity Building, based in BOARDMAN, OR.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. As of 2024, the organization holds $3.1M in total assets. In 2024, it awarded 4 grants totaling $163K. Net investment income was $1K.

Giving History
Grant recipients and amounts by year
Among its reported 2024 grants, the largest include Boardman Park and Recreation District ($94,900), Families First Day Care ($35,000), Boardman Senior Citizens Inc ($18,050).
| Recipient | Purpose | Amount |
|---|---|---|
| Boardman Park and Recreation District Boardman, OR | Staffing Assistance | $94,900 |
| Families First Day Care Boardman, OR | Funds for operational assistance | $35,000 |
| Morrow County School District Heppner, OR | Funding for track equipment | $15,000 |
| Boardman Senior Citizens Inc Boardman, OR | Capital project assistance | $18,050 |
